Golden Mean Partnership

Golden Mean Partnership LLC is a single family office. A private investment entity managing capital for an undisclosed family.

Golden Mean Partnership

Golden Mean Partnership is a single-family office formed to manage the investment affairs of a private family. How does Golden Mean Partnership source investment opportunities?

Without a public website or marketing materials, the firm likely relies on a network of existing relationships with investment banks, law firms, and co-investment partners. Many family offices of this type access deal flow through established intermediaries rather than public channels.

What is the minimum investment commitment for Golden Mean Partnership?

The firm does not disclose minimum investment thresholds. As a single-family office managing a single family's assets rather than external capital, the concept of a minimum commitment is not applicable. No fund offerings to outside investors have been reported.
